Beside live corners feature in InDesign CS5 which allows us to set roundness of all corners or for each corner separately there are and some very cool built in corner effects like Fancy, Bevel…
Let’s start with live corners. Just to mention that I am using free InDesign template Calipso which you can download from here. When you have rectangle or square shape, path or frame in your document click on it and yellow square will appear near right top corner. In case you do not see yellow square go to View > Extras > Show Live Corners to enable live corners feature. From the same menu you can hide live corners. Note: you can not apply corner effect to the smooth path (shape, frame).
After clicking yellow square you will see 4 diamonds appears on the selected frame or shape (you can convert any shape to frame). To set corner radius click on any diamond and drag. While dragging pop-up will appear and show you amount of corner radius (R=17 mm for example).
To set different radius for each corner, hold down Shift then click diamond and drag.
To cycle through different built in corner effects hold down Alt key and click diamond. You can change individual corners and after applying built in corner effects. Hold down Shift, click and drag diamond. To exit click anywhere outside of frame.
Corner effects are available from Object menu. First select object using Selection tool then go to Object > Corner Options. Corner Options dialog will appear. In the middle of dialog is chain icon. Click (Make all settings the same – chain icon) to set the same corner effect for all corners then choose effect from drop-down list on the right side. If you want different corner effect for each corner click chain again (broken chain icon will appear) and set effect for each corner separately. Turn on Preview to see instantly corner effects.
Same dialog is available from options bar below menus. With frame or shape selected hold down Alt key and click square with 4 blue dots to open Corner Options dialog.
In case you want to remove corner effects first ensure Make all settings the same have normal chain icon (not broken) then choose None from any drop – down list on the right side of corner.
Actually you can apply built-in corner effects from options bar without opening any dialog but this method works only to apply same for all corners, you can not set different effect for each corner independently. To save time if you want same effect for multiple objects, select them all then apply corner effect.
When you have other non-smooth paths like pentagon, hexagon yellow square will not appear when you select path but you can still apply corner effect to the path (shape, frame). Select path using Selection tool then open Corner Options dialog from Object > Corner Options. In this case you must apply same corner effect to all corners, different effect for each corner won’t be available (grayed out).
